About J. Touš

J. Touš is a scholar working on Plant Science, Nutrition and Dietetics, Endocrinology, Food Science and Organic Chemistry, having authored 64 papers that have together received 854 indexed citations. Recurring topics across this work include Plant Physiology and Cultivation Studies (26 papers), Nuts composition and effects (26 papers), Horticultural and Viticultural Research (21 papers), Plant and Fungal Interactions Research (17 papers), Polysaccharides Composition and Applications (9 papers), Edible Oils Quality and Analysis (9 papers), Garlic and Onion Studies (6 papers) and Peanut Plant Research Studies (6 papers). The work is most often cited by research in Food Science (293 citations), Nutrition and Dietetics (206 citations), Plant Science (524 citations), Biochemistry (66 citations) and Endocrinology (54 citations). J. Touš has collaborated with scholars based in Spain, Italy and Libya. Frequent co-authors include A. Romero, J.F. Hermoso, I. Batlle, Stefania Vichi, M. Rovira, Susana Buxaderas, A. Ninot, Elvira López‐Tamames, Mohamed Boussaïd and Josep Caixach. Their work appears in journals such as HortScience, Journal of Agricultural and Food Chemistry, HortTechnology, Journal of Ecology and Food Chemistry.
